2012-04-06 73 views
-2

我有一个链接将我带入图片。我将如何访问此链接并在Android中显示此链接?在Android中添加图片视图

例如:http://chart.finance.yahoo.com/z?s=GOOG&t=6m&q=l返回图形。如何在Android中使用此图表(下载和显示)?

回答

1

您可以使用HTPPGET连接来获取URL的连接。所以如果你使用HTTPGET,你会得到一个输入流。

一旦获得输入流,只需将该输入流转换为Bitmap或drawable并根据需要使用。

示例代码如下。

HttpParams httpParameters = new BasicHttpParams(); 
HttpConnectionParams.setConnectionTimeout(httpParameters, 30000); 
HttpConnectionParams.setSoTimeout(httpParameters, 30000); 
HttpClient httpclient = new DefaultHttpClient(httpParameters); 
HttpGet httpGet = new HttpGet(url); 
HttpResponse httpResponse = httpclient.execute(httpGet); 
in = httpResponse.getEntity().getContent(); 
Bitmap bmp = BitmapFactory.decodeStream(instream); 

所以你可以根据需要使用这个位图,你需要处理所有的连接异常。

+0

有没有什么好的教程解释如何实现这个 – user1092042 2012-04-06 03:16:57

+0

谢谢让我试试看。 – user1092042 2012-04-06 03:22:01